The landscape for mature women in entertainment and cinema is undergoing a profound transformation, moving from a "narrative of decline" toward a new era of visibility and influence. Historically, the industry has favored female youth, with many actresses seeing their leading roles dwindle after age 30. However, recent years have seen a "ripple" of change turn into a "wave" as women over 50 and 60 anchor major films, lead prestige television, and win top accolades. For decades, the "Celluloid Ceiling" for women in Hollywood was often set at age 40. Beyond that mark, roles typically shifted from leading protagonists to the periphery—mothers, grandmothers, or the "shrewish" boss. However, by 2026, a significant cultural shift is rewriting this narrative. The lack of representation for older women in front of the camera is inextricably linked to the lack of diversity among the gatekeepers behind it. The film industry remains a heavily male-dominated space, and the problem is worsening under the weight of industry consolidation and political pushback. "It would not be a stretch to describe 2025 as an ominous moment for the film industry," said Dr. Lauzen in her "Celluloid Ceiling" report, noting that consolidation, potential job losses, and "the current political war on diversity" have put women in the film industry "in uncharted territory".
